Minutes:

2.1                 The Committee considered a report of the Monitoring Officer that provided information on the Committee’s Terms of Reference and related matters including the appointment of its urgency sub-committee.

 

2.2                 Councillor Janio asked how the Members for an urgency sub-committee would be selected.

 

2.3                 The Acting Assistant Head of Law clarified that an urgency sub-committee would comprise of the Chair and one Member each from the two other political groups who would be nominated by the respective Group Leaders. Any decisions taken by the urgency sub-committee would be reported to the next regular Environment & Sustainability Committee.

 

2.4                 RESOLVED-

 

1.      That the Committee’s Terms of Reference, as set out in Appendix A to the report be noted.

 

2.      That the establishment of an urgency Sub-Committee consisting of the Chair of the Committee and two other Members (nominated in accordance with the scheme for the allocation of seats for the committees), to exercise its powers in relation to matters of urgency, on which it is necessary to make a decision before the next ordinary meeting of the Committee be approved.
